Overview
San Mateo County's IHSS program is administered by San Mateo County Health, with the San Mateo County Public Authority serving as Employer of Record and operating the provider registry — one of the highest-paying counties in California, second only to San Francisco.
Applications and general assistance route through the county's Aging and Disability Services Line, while payroll, timesheets, and registry questions are handled separately by the Public Authority.

Local Notes & Quirks
- One of the highest-paying counties in the state: At $21.70/hr, San Mateo trails only San Francisco statewide — a reflection of the Bay Area's cost of living and years of SEIU 2015 bargaining.
- Separate application and payroll lines: Applying for IHSS goes through the Aging and Disability Services Line, while the Public Authority itself handles payroll, timesheets, and the provider registry — two different numbers for two different needs.
- Provider benefits beyond wages: San Mateo offers eligible providers voluntary health and dental/vision insurance, paid sick leave, a public transportation benefit, and reimbursement for pre-approved caregiving classes.
Appealing a Notice of Action in San Mateo County
If San Mateo County reduces, denies, or terminates your IHSS hours, the appeal process is governed by state regulation — the same 90-day deadline applies regardless of county:
- You have 90 days from the date on your Notice of Action to request a State Hearing
- Call the State Hearings Division at 1-800-952-5253 to request a hearing
- Or mail a written request to: California Department of Social Services, State Hearings Division, P.O. Box 944243, Sacramento, CA 94244
- Requesting your hearing before the Notice of Action's effective date preserves Aid Paid Pending — meaning you keep your current hours while the appeal is decided
For free legal help with a San Mateo County IHSS appeal, Disability Rights California can be reached at 1-800-776-5746.
